Автор работы: Пользователь скрыл имя, 10 Декабря 2012 в 16:36, дипломная работа
Дипломная работа посвящена описанию опыта создания распределенной информационно-управляющей системы ПоТок-С для филиала ПТС ОАО “Северо-Западный Телеком”, которая в настоящее время сдана в опытную эксплуатацию. Следует сказать, что ОАО “Северо-Западный Телеком” была одной из первых организаций в России, в которой в 1996 году начались работы по использованию систем для мониторинга режимов теплоснабжения и коммерческого учета потребления тепла сооружениями этой организации. Сложившаяся инфраструктура позволила в рамках выполнения этого проекта провести ряд исследований и демонстрационных экспериментов, результаты которых представляют интерес для системных интеграторов подобного рода проектов, а также для целого ряда смежных областей.
ОБОЗНАЧЕНИЯ И СОКРАЩЕНИЯ…………………………………………………………………3
ВВЕДЕНИЕ……………………………………………………………………………………….……4
1 ОБЗОР НАУЧНО-ТЕХНИЧЕСКОЙ ЛИТЕРАТУРЫ И ПАТЕНТОВ…………….…….…….6
1.1 Обзор систем мониторинга и управления распределенными объектами ……….…....6
1.2 Обзор контроллеров и встраиваемых компьютеров ……………………………………..21
2 ПОСТАНОВКА ЗАДАЧИ…………………………………………………………………………40
2.1 Описание проблематики……………………………………………………………………40
2.2 Общие требования к системам класса ИУС (СДМУ)…………………………………….41
2.3 Особенности построения и концепция РИУС ПоТок-С………………………………….43
2.4 Требования к программному обеспечению системы……………………………………..46
3 РАЗРАБОТКА ПРОГРАММНОГО ОБЕСПЕЧЕНИЯ…………………………………….……..48
3.1 Низкоуровневое ПО контроллера ASK-Lab……………………….……………………...48
3.2 Высокоуровневое ПО системы видеоконтроля……………….………………………….68
4 ОЦЕНКА РЕЗУЛЬТАТОВ РАЗРАБОТКИ…………………………………………….…….......76
4.1 Оценка результатов разработанной системы…………………………………………….76
4.2 Оценка результатов разработанного ПО контроллера ASK-Lab……………………….78
4.3 Результаты применения системы видеоконтроля ……………………………….………80
ЗАКЛЮЧЕНИЕ…………………………………………………………………………………...….83
СПИСОК ИСПОЛЬЗОВАННЫХ ИСТОЧНИКОВ………………….……………………………..85
1.1.6 “Логика”
В источнике [15] описывается новая информационно-измерительная система “Логика” для коммерческого и технического учета энергоресурсов.
Преимущества, отличительные особенности
Функциональные возможности
Аппаратное обеспечение ИИС ЛОГИКА показано на рисунке 1.4.
1.1.7 Выводы
В таблице 1.1 приведено краткое описание ряда эксплуатирующихся в настоящее время систем класса ИС и ИУС.
Примеры систем, представленные в обзоре, отражают ряд характерных тенденций в развитии систем коммерческого учета. Отобранные примеры отражают отчетливую тенденцию перехода от чисто информационных систем (ИС) к информационно-управляющим системам (ИУС), так как только последние обеспечивают возможность реальной экономии средств.
Второй вывод, который следует из обзора, заключается в том, что до настоящего времени ведется как выбор каналов связи для сбора информации с объектов и передачи команд управления, так и аппаратного обеспечения нижнего уровня.
Следует отметить одну важную особенность систем подобного рода. В силу значительного масштаба и достаточно большой стоимости эти системы обладают значительной инерцией в смысле возможности изменения в однажды принятых концептуальных решениях. В силу этого с практической точки зрения представляет интерес анализ особенностей систем, используемых на практике.
Название |
Назначение |
Верхний уровень системы |
Нижний уровень системы |
Коммуникация |
Количество узлов |
КРУГ 2000 |
ИУС для коммерческого учета тепловой энергии и газопотребления для крупных промышленных предприятий |
ЛВС (сеть предприятия) с возможностью входа сторонних пользователей посредством браузера Internet |
Цифровые интеллект. датчики и контроллеры с интерфейсами RS-232,RS-485,Ethernet |
Витая пара и локальные проводные соединения |
Проектная спецификация - до 30 000. |
Синтал Телетерм |
ИУС для автоматического регулирования тепловых режимов крупного сооружения (Дворец спорта в г. отапливаемого электрокотлами |
ПК c ПО, обеспечивающем мониторинг состояния объектов, задание режимов регулирования, дистантное управление, обработку учетной информации |
Цифровые регуляторы ЭЦР-ХРОНО подкл. к контролл. ЭЦРТ-ТЕЛЕТЕРМ |
Радиоканал на GSM модемах |
В системе используется 96 датчиков DS18S20 и 17 силовых шкафов управления электро-котлами. |
КАРАТ |
Автоматизированная система контроля и коммерческого учета режимов теплоснабжения городских объектов городской инфраструктуры (г.Калининград). |
Ведущий и резервный диспетчерский пульты, реализованные на ПК, об. по ЛВС |
Шкаф управления На базе ADAM –5510 ADAM-501H ADAM-5050 ADAM3854 |
сети сотовой связи GSM на модемах Siemens TC35 Terminal |
Проектная спецификация до 50 теплопунктов |
Телескоп+ |
Автоматизированная ИУС для
коммерческого учета |
АРМ ы диспетчеров, операторов и пользователей системы |
Контроллеры ПИК-УВП, ПИК2 |
Сбор информации осуществляется по радиоканалу (УКВ), комм. тел. линия, оптоволокно |
100 узлов |
«Интек» |
ИУС тепло- и водоучета, диспетчеризация различных промышленных объектов. |
центральный компьютер с ПО обеспечивающим мониторинг. Возможно управление процессами |
контроллеры SCADAPack или DirectLOGIC, приборы учета воды и тепла, оборудование SonyEriccson, Wavecom для передачи по GSM каналу |
каналы проводной связи, ADSL, GSM, GPRS |
До 500 (по GSM каналу) |
Логика |
Информационно-измерительная |
сбор и соответствующее предста |
серийно-выпускаемые спец. вычислители, преобразователи, счетчики ЗАО НПФ ЛОГИКА |
Коммутируемые и некоммутируемые линии связи, радиоканал. |
неизвестно |
1.2 Обзор контроллеров и встраиваемых компьютеров
Научно-библиографический поиск проводился для обзора современных контроллеров и встраиваемых компьютеров (включая примеры использования специализированных роботов), используемых для работы в составе информационно-управляющих системах. Поиск вёлся по следующим источникам: каталог «RTSoft Средства и системы автоматизации. Каталог продукции», журнал «Системная интеграция», труды конференции «Коммерческий учет энергоносителей», материалы сайтов www.English.Eastday.com, www.Tral.ru, www.mzta.ru, www.Prosoft.ru, www.nevabls.ru за период с 2002 по 2005 год.
1.2.1 Контроллер ThinkIO
В источнике [16] рассмотрен контроллер ThinkIO. ThinkIO— это комбинация стандартного компьютера (на базе процессора класса Intel® Pentium MMX 266 МГц) с модульными системами WAGO-IO/-SYSTEM 750 и 753.
WAGO-I/O-SYSTEM 750 и 753 — миниатюрные модульные системы ввода/вывода для распределенных систем управления, не зависящие от типа промышленных шин. Они позволяют создавать экономичные и компактные узлы ввода/ вывода на базе сочетающихся друг с другом специализированных модулей цифрового и аналогового ввода/ вывода.
Конфигурирование ThinklO может осуществляться с помощью системы программирования PLC CoDeSys, удовлетворяющей требованиям стандарта IEC 61131-1.
В контроллере ThinklO имеются порты USB, 2xEthernet, RS232, DV1 и внешний сторожевой таймер, обеспечивая поддержку промышленных шин типа PROFUBUS-DP, CANopen или DeviceNet.
Внешний вид контроллера ThinkIO представлен на рисунке 1.5.
Технические характеристики
Подключение устройств
- Два канала цифрового ввода и вывода с опторазвязкой
Коммутационные модули (интерфейсы)
- 2x USB 1.1;
- 1x nopTRS232;
- 2x 10Base-T/lOOBase-TX Fast Ethernet;
- 1x DVI-I.
Системные устройства
- Внешний сторожевой таймер;
- Кнопка пуска/останова;
- Кнопка сброса.
Системный процессор
- Geode 5C1200 (266 МГц) и интегрированный микропроцессорный набор AMD;
- Кэш: 16 Кбайт L1.
Память
- Загрузочный встроенный флэш-диск 32/128 Мбайт;
- SDRAM: 32/128 Мбайт;
- RAM: 128 Кбайт с аккумуляторным питанием;
- CompactFlash Type I/II.
Внешние шины
- PROFIBUS-DP Master/Slave;
- CANopen Master/Slave;
- DeviceNet Master/Slave.
Корпус
- Размеры 160 x 70 x 95 мм
Операционная система
- Поддержка Windows CE;
- Поддержка Linux.
Программное обеспечение
- Среда программирования CoDeSys со средствами визуализации целевых систем;
- IEC 61131-З/lSaGraf;
- ОРС Driver;
- SOPH.I.A.;
- CFC 6 (вариант языка FBD).
1.2.2 Роботы для слежения за электрической сетью
В источнике [17] говорится о том, что в Китае разработан работ для слежения за электрической сетью.
Ученые восточной провинции Китай Шандонг объявили, что закончились десятидневные испытания робота, следившего за трансформаторной подстанцией напряжения 500000 Вольт.
Четырехколесный робот,
разработанный Шандонгским
В Китае до сих пор трансформаторные подстанции обслуживались только людьми, безопасность которых не была гарантирована из-за сетей, постоянно находящихся под высоким напряжением, и часто тяжелых погодных условий.
Ученые из Шандонгского
центра заявили, что во время проведения
эксперимента робот мог как выполнять
функции рабочих
После того, как технология будет отлажена, вероятно, будет налажено массовое производство робота, заявила группа ученых.
1.2.3 Контроллер SCADAPack
В работе [18] рассмотрены контроллеры SCADAPack, поставляемые компанией «ПЛКСистемы», благодаря своим характеристикам и возможностям, успешно применяются в системах коммерческого учета самого различного назначения.
Контроллеры SCADAPack стали базовым средством автоматизации в сертифицированных системах «ЭКОТЭЛ» (ООО «Фирма РКК»), «ИНТЭК» (ООО «Реалтехносервис»), предназначенных для сбора данных и диспетчерского управления в коммунальном хозяйстве, химической, газовой и нефтяной промышленности, а так же на других объектах энергопотребления (энергоснабжения), требующих комплексной автоматизации при ведении многотарифного учета для оптимизации финансовых затрат по оплате полученных (оглушенных) энергоресурсов. Эти системы позволяют вести оперативный учет потребленных энергоносителей, осуществлять контроль параметров горячего и холодного водоснабжения, отопления.
Четыре серии контроллеров SCADAPack
позволяют строить системы
Коммутационные возможности позволяют организовывать устойчивую связь с технологическими объектами по любым каналам связи.
Помехозащищенное исполнение
позволяет размещать
Контроллеры SCADAPAck сочетают свойства RTU, высокую производительность и возможность свободного программирования современных промышленных компьютеров, что отличает их от традиционных контроллеров телемеханики.
Контроллеры SCADAPack соответствуют требованиям открытых систем, легко интегрируются в существующие комплексы АСУТП и взаимодействуют со средствами автоматизации других производителей.
Надежность, возможность дистанционной диагностики и программирования существенно снижают затраты при эксплуатации автоматизированной системы. Контроллеры SCADAPack рассчитаны на применение в долгосрочных проектах.
Технические характеристики
Подключение устройств
- до 40 дополнительных модулей;
- возможность обрабатывать свыше 1100 каналов ввода/вывода.
Коммутационные модули
- радиомодемы;
- модемы для выделенных
и коммутируемых телефонных
- модули Ethernet;
- возможно подключение различных типов радиостанций;
- работа через спутниковую и сотовую связь;
- возможность программирования
на переключение на
Системный процессор
- 32-разрядный процессор 120 МГц
Память
- RAM: 8 Мбайт с аккумуляторным питанием;
- Flash: 4 Мбайт;
Поддерживаемые протоколы
- Modbus RTU/ASC1I/TCP/UDP;
- DNP3;
- DF1;
- HART;
- На языке C/C++ возможно
написание собственных
Рабочий температурный диапазон:
- 40 .. +70 °C
Операционная система
- нет
Программное обеспечение
- язык релейной логики;
- C/C++;
- IEC 61131-З/lSaGraf.
1.2.4 Одноплатный компьютер NetCore
В источнике [19] рассмотрен вычислитель NetCore - одноплатный компьютер на базе процессора AMD Alchemy Au1000 - процессор класса «система на кристалле» (SOC) с набором инструкций MIPS32™, включающий усовершенствованное ядро центрального процессора, адаптированный контроллер памяти и комплект стандартных коммуникационных периферийных модулей.
Применение одноплатных компьютеров NetCore в таких областях, как автоматизация технологических процессов, сбор и обработка данных, управление оборудованием, испытательные системы, общественный транспорт, информационные системы и мобильная техника делают его экономически-эффективной встраиваемой платформой. Операционная система Linux 2.4 позволяет компьютеру реализовать перечисленные задачи.
Устройство позволяет обрабатывать и накапливать потоки, поступающие по последовательным интерфейсам и передавать их в локальную сеть. NetCore обладает мощными вычислительными ресурсами и ОС Linux это позволяет решать прикладные задачи с поступающими потоками (ведение баз данных и их первичная обработка). В частности в проекте "интеллектуальное здание" устройство используется для сбора информации с электро- и теплосчетчиков.
Информация о работе Распределенная информационно- управляющая система поток-С